Frage : Excel 2010 - Mitteilungkasten für drei Schritte

Wenn ich ein bestimmtes Blatt öffne, das ich möchte, dass Excel 2010 mich fragt (oder wer auch immer öffnet das Blatt), das following

`wurde Sie mögen die späteste Datenzufuhrfrage importieren, wenn `ja' dann spezifischen macro
Once Durchlauf laufen lassen, wurden Sie mögen auf neuen Produktserien überprüfen, wenn `ja' der Durchlauf ein spezifischen macro
Again einmal Durchlauf, wurden Sie mögen die Preislisteformeln formatieren, wenn `ja' dann ein spezifisches macro.

If kein gesagt jederzeit, entleeren heraus zum Preisliste-Blatt laufen lassen. alle

Once abschließen, „eine Arbeit zuweist komplettes, haben ein schöner Tag“

I wurde eher diese Mitteilungkästen als die Rückstellung. Die Knöpfe, zum jedes Elements manuell laufen zu lassen sind auch auf dem Blatt, aber es wurde nett, wenn, das Blatt öffnend, weg von diesem Mitteilungkasten sequence

Thanks
abfeuerte

Antwort : Excel 2010 - Mitteilungkasten für drei Schritte

Privates VorWorkbook_Open ()
wenn MsgBox („wurde Sie mögen die späteste Datenzufuhr importieren fragen? “, „Importdatenzufuhr“, vbYesNo) =vbYes dann
  MacroName1
  wenn MsgBox („wurde Sie mögen auf neuen Produktserien überprüfen? “, „ÜberprüfungsProduktserien“, vbYesNo) =vbYes dann
    MacroName2
    wenn MsgBox („wurde Sie mögen die Preislisteformeln formatieren? “, „Formatlistenformeln“, vbYesNo) =vbYes dann
      MacroName3
    beenden wenn
  beenden wenn
beenden wenn
Weitere Lösungen  
 
programming4us programming4us